PVC Tarp: A Durable Solution for Heavy-Duty Protection
PVC tarp, short for polyvinyl chloride tarpaulin, is a versatile, durable, and waterproof material widely used for industrial, commercial, and personal applications. Designed to withstand harsh weather and rough handling, PVC tarps are a top choice for anyone needing strong and long-lasting protective covers.
What is a PVC Tarp?PVC tarpaulin is made by coating a polyester fabric base with polyvinyl chloride (PVC). This process gives the material excellent tensile strength, flexibility, and resistance to water, UV rays, chemicals, and abrasion. The result is a heavy-duty tarp that performs reliably in tough conditions.
Key Features of PVC Tarps- 
Waterproof 
 PVC tarps are 100% waterproof, making them ideal for covering goods, vehicles, and construction sites exposed to rain or moisture.
- 
UV Resistant 
 The UV-resistant coating protects against sun damage, preventing cracking, fading, or weakening over time.
- 
Tear and Abrasion Resistant 
 Reinforced with strong polyester threads, PVC tarps resist tearing and puncturing, even under mechanical stress.
- 
Fire Retardant (Optional) 
 Fire-retardant versions are available for safety-sensitive environments like welding sites or event tents.
- 
Customizable 
 PVC tarps come in various colors, sizes, thicknesses (usually between 10–30 mils), and grades to match different application needs.
- 
Truck Covers & Trailer Tarps 
 Protect cargo during transportation from rain, dust, and wind.
- 
Construction Site Covers 
 Cover scaffolding, machinery, or building materials on site.
- 
Agricultural Use 
 Shelter for livestock, hay, and equipment.
- 
Tents & Outdoor Events 
 Used as tent roofing or sidewalls for durability and weather resistance.
- 
Swimming Pool Covers 
 Prevent debris accumulation and water evaporation.
- 
Industrial Curtains & Dividers 
 Ideal for creating flexible barriers in factories or workshops.
Compared to polyethylene (PE) tarps, PVC tarps are heavier, more robust, and longer-lasting. While PE tarps are suitable for light-duty and short-term use, PVC tarps are better suited for extended outdoor exposure and industrial demands.
Maintenance Tips- 
Clean regularly with mild soap and water. 
- 
Avoid sharp objects that can puncture the material. 
- 
Store in a dry, shaded place when not in use.
